AFC Cup: Basundhara Kings beat Gokulam Kerala to go top of the group

Bangladeshi side Basundhara Kings go top of Group D in the AFC Cup with a 2-1 win against I-League champions Gokulam Kerala at the Salt Lake Stadium in Kolkata on Tuesday.

Robinho (36') scored one and turned provider for Nuha Marong (54'). The south-Indian side did pull one back with the help of Jourdaine Fletcher (75'), however, it wasn't enough thanks to the Kings' goalkeeper Anisur Rahman, who made a few crucial saves for the Kings in either half.

The Kings started their campaign with a 1-0 win over Maziya before being romped 4-0 by Indian Super League side ATK Mohun Bagan before coming into this game.

They now have six points in three games while Gokulam Kerala end their campaign last on three points.

The Kings will have to wait for the last group game between ATK Mohun Bagan and Maziya later tonight to see if they qualify for the zonal semifinals or no.

A win for ATK Mohun Bagan will see them through at the expense of the Kings based on their head-to-head record, whereas any other result will see the Kings qualify ahead of the Kolkata based side.
